2012年3月3日
摘要: HTML5是如今比较火的一个技术,了解了一段时间后发现它的前途的确很好,虽然目前还没有正式发布,但是各大浏览器厂商早已经行动了,国内的磊友已经开发出了基于HTML5的游戏《黎明帝国》等。目前浏览器支持最好的当属Chrome,Firefox也不错。开发工具可以使用DreamWeaver,但是HTML5中的特性没有自动提示功能。那么HTML5到底是什么呢?HTML5=HTML+CSS+JS一、为什么要用HTML5呢1、基于HTML5视频将是未来的web视频 HTML5支持的video和audio标签将会是未来的web音视频,这样就不用安装flash播放器了,2、播放器直接简历在浏览器内部 也就.. 阅读全文
posted @ 2012-03-03 22:14 花郎V 阅读(1376) 评论(3) 推荐(0) 编辑
摘要: 单一职责原则(Single Responsibility Principle),简称SRP。定义:There should never be more than one reason for a class to change.应该有且仅有一个原因引起类的变更。有时候,开发人员设计接口的时候会有些问题,比如用户的属性和用户的行为被放在一个接口中声明。这就造成了业务对象和业务逻辑被放在了一起,这样就造成了这个接口有两种职责,接口职责不明确,按照SRP的定义就违背了接口的单一职责原则了。下面是个例子:package com.loulijun.chapter1;public interface It 阅读全文
posted @ 2012-03-03 20:31 花郎V 阅读(2859) 评论(0) 推荐(2) 编辑